Anil is a masculine Turkish and Indian name. In Turkish, it means “Righteous Ruler”, “Just Emperor” and “to be remembered forever”. In the Indian Sanskrit language it can be defined as the “The God of the Air and the Wind”. Notable persons with this name include:

Pehlivan or Pahlevan derives from Iranian language word meaning noble, wrestler, hero or champion and it is a loan word in many Asiatic languages as well as middle eastern languages including Turkish surname originally given to wrestlers. The name of Feyli (Pehli) Kurds is also deriving from the same root word. The word consist of two Iranic (Aryen) word "pehli" or "pahli" and "van, wan". While peh, pah is root word for hero "van" or "wan" is a suffix similar as in "er, or" in soldier, warrior, wrestler, shopper.
